    Project Engineer

    Project Engineer Responsibilities:

    • Preparing, scheduling, coordinating, and monitoring of assigned engineering projects.
    • Formulating project parameters and assigning responsibilities to the most capable employees and monitoring the project team.
    • Interacting with clients, interpreting their needs and requirements, and representing them in the field.
    • Performing quality control tasks on budgets, schedules, plans, and personnel performance and reporting on the project's status.
    • Cooperating and communicating with the project manager and other project participants and collaborating with senior engineers to create more efficient project methods and to maintain the project's profitability.
    • Reviewing the engineering tasks and initiating the necessary corrective actions.
    • Developing specifications for the project's needed equipment.
    • Creating frameworks to measure the project's metrics and data collection.
    • Establishing field test methods and methods for monitoring the quality of those tests.
    • Ensuring the project's compliance with the applicable codes, practices, policies, performance standards, and specifications.

    Project Engineer Requirements:

    • A Bachelor's degree in engineering or a related field.
    • A valid engineering license.
    • 4 or more years' field and project planning experience.
    • Excellent computer literacy and knowledge of design and visualization software.
    • The ability to work with multiple discipline projects.
    • Excellent project management and supervision skills.
    • Excellent organizational, time management, leadership, and decision-making skills.
    •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
    • Knowledge of applicable codes, policies, standards, and best practices.
